目的研究镧对学习记忆的影响,并从大脑皮质即刻早期基因表达的角度探讨镧影响学习记忆的机制。方法40只成年雌性Wistar大鼠随机分成对照组和低、中、高剂量染镧组,染镧组仔鼠在出生至断乳后1个月期间染镧,然后进行神经行为学测试(水迷宫和穿梭箱测试),测定大脑皮质中c-fosmRNA和c-Fos蛋白以及尼氏体表达情况。结果神经行为学测试结果显示染镧组仔鼠的学习记忆能力明显低于对照水平,呈现一定的量-效关系。低剂量染镧组仔鼠大脑皮质c-fosmRNA和c-Fos蛋白表达水平明显低于对照水平,中剂量染镧组仔鼠海马c-fosmRNA表达水平明显低于对照水平,c-Fos蛋白表达水平明显低于对照和低剂量染镧组,高剂量染镧组仔鼠大脑皮质c-fosmRNA和c-Fos蛋白表达水平均明显低于对照和低剂量染镧组。另外,低剂量染镧组大脑皮质神经细胞中尼氏体表达水平明显低于对照水平,中、高剂量染镧组大脑皮质神经细胞中尼氏体表达水平进一步减少。结论染镧造成学习记忆能力下降,这可能与染镧引起大脑皮质即刻早期基因的基因和蛋白表达水平下降、神经细胞功能削弱有一定关系。
Objective To study the effect of lanthanum on learning and memory and to explore the mechanism of lanthanum-influenced learning and memory from the perspective of early gene expression in the cerebral cortex. Methods Forty adult female Wistar rats were randomly divided into control group and low, medium and high dose groups of lanthanum. The lanthanum group was lased with lanthanum for one month from birth to weaning, and then neurobehavioral test (water maze And shuttle box test) to determine c-fos mRNA and c-Fos protein and Nissl expression in the cerebral cortex. Results The neurobehavioral test results showed that the learning and memory abilities of the pups of the lanthanum-doped group were significantly lower than those of the control group, showing a dose-effect relationship. The expression of c-fos mRNA and c-Fos protein in cerebral cortex of low-dose lanthanum group was significantly lower than that of the control group. The expression of c-fos mRNA in hippocampus of medium dose lanthanum group was significantly lower than that of the control group Significantly lower than the control group and the low-dose lanthanum group. The expression of c-fos mRNA and c-Fos protein in cerebral cortex of the high-dose lanthanum-loaded group were significantly lower than those of the control group and the low-dose lanthanum group. In addition, the expression of Nissl in cerebral cortical neurons of low-dose lanthanum-treated group was significantly lower than that of control group, while the expression of Nissl in cerebral cortex neurons of medium and high-dose lanthanum group was further reduced. Conclusion Dye lanthanum can reduce the ability of learning and memory, which may be related to the decrease of gene and protein expression of early gene in the cerebral cortex, and the impaired function of nerve cells.
